To help Johns Hopkins University illustrate the passion of its faculty, staff, and students — and to dispel the prevailing image of JHU as “stodgy” — the University’s in-house production team called on Take One to shoot this intriguing 30-second recruitment spot.
The spot juxtaposes a passionate student (who is also the 2006 International Jump Rope Champion) alongside the University’s equally passionate 2003 Nobel Prize winner in chemistry.
No stranger to passion ourselves, we were pleased to shoot the spot in the hi-def DVCPRO HD format. We then finished the University’s off-line edit on our Avid Adrenaline DNxHD system, resulting in an extremely effective joint production designed to air on ESPN-U and in regional broadcast markets.
(At the end of this clip we’ve appended a fun 1-minute time lapse video of the spot’s 10-hour production day, demonstrating how a typical video shoot progresses from set-up to shooting to wrap.)
